Simplified Explanation:

The patent application describes a vehicle driving assistance apparatus that controls the speed of a vehicle on curved roads to maintain a safe speed.

  • The apparatus adjusts the speed of the vehicle to match a target speed or lower when the vehicle is moving on a curved road and exceeds the target speed.
  • It ensures that the deceleration of the vehicle is minimal when the vehicle is within the drivable area of the curved road, compared to when it goes beyond the outer boundary of the drivable area.

Original Abstract Submitted

a vehicle driving assistance apparatus executes a speed control of controlling a moving speed of an own vehicle to a target speed or less when the own vehicle moves on a curved road, and the moving speed of the own vehicle is greater than the target speed. while executing the speed control, the vehicle driving assistance apparatus controls a deceleration of the own vehicle by the speed control such that a deceleration of the own vehicle realized when an own vehicle moving course is within a drivable area of the curved road, is smaller than the deceleration of the own vehicle realized when a part of the own vehicle moving course is out of an outer boundary of the drivable area.
